#97b79c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#97b79c is composed of 59.2% red, 71.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 129.4 degrees, a saturation of 18.2% and a lightness of 65.5%. #97b79c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f6f39.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#97b79c color description : Grayish lime green.
#97b79c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#97b79c has RGB values of R:151, G:183,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 9942940.

Shades and Tints of #97b79c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f4 is the lightest one.
